Transaction ec08da32379b552b649c9aa66bc6b55ee103aec81cd92e5af02e493b96ba68ae

1 Input
2 Outputs
  • ec08da32379b552b649c9aa66bc6b55ee103aec81cd92e5af02e493b96ba68ae:0
  • value  620727
    address  33nebr94r4kmiMyGofExUsCXwPNRqsBJ4D
  • ec08da32379b552b649c9aa66bc6b55ee103aec81cd92e5af02e493b96ba68ae:1
  • value  73635281
    address  bc1qkdwl636qd5c3dj02dnt8e7tcnjk4dr6k0xde7j2p8kg9wgkstthqp5pugy